INGREDIENTS:

Ridiculously Rich Chocolate Brownies (or your own if you fancy making some first!)

Dark Chocolate (this looks the best, but milk chocolate will work too)

White, Green and Red Icing

Cake pop sticks 

 

RECIPE:

Add the Ridiculously Rich Brownies into the mixer and until they begin to form into a dough.

Roll the mixture into small sized balls, insert cake pop sticks to one end and put in freezer for 1 hour to set.

Melt the dark chocolate over the hob or using a microwave, be careful not to burn!

Once the cake pops are set, dip the cake pops into the melted chocolate, ensuring to cover entirely and leave to harden.

Cut the white icing into circles to use as the brandy sauce, green icing as the holly leaves and red icing as berries.

There you have your mini Christmas puddings, perfect for a festive treat!
